1. A method for manufacturing a light modulation device, comprising:
transferring a first substrate between a first unwind roll and a take-up roll, wherein an adhesive layer is disposed on a first surface of the first substrate, wherein the adhesive layer comprises a cured product of a curable adhesive composition;
transferring a second substrate between a second unwind roll and the take-up roll, wherein the second substrate includes a spacer and a liquid crystal alignment film formed on a first surface of the second substrate during the transfer and prior to an attachment with the adhesive layer of the first substrate;
attaching the first and second substrates via respective first surfaces thereof by passing the first and second substrates through an opening between adjacent attachment rolls to form a light modulation device; and
heat-treating the first substrate before the attaching of the first and second substrates,
wherein the light modulation device comprises the first surface and the second substrate having the spacer, liquid crystal alignment film and the adhesive layer disposed therebetween, and wherein the spacer maintains a gap between the first and second substrates.
